This is where enters the scene. Originating as a fork of the older AsProgrammer, NeoProgrammer is an open-source software project that provides a clean, powerful, and reliable interface for the CH341A and other programmers. The specific version referenced— v2.1.0.19 (often written as 21019)—represents a mature build in the software’s evolution. This version is notable for several key improvements: an extensive database of supported chips (over 500+ devices, from 24xxx EEPROMs to 25xxx and 93xxx series), a stable driver stack for modern Windows versions (10 and 11), intelligent auto-detection of chip models, and crucial safety features like voltage verification and read/write verification.
: Version 2.1.0.19 specifically fixed detection issues for older SPI components and improved protection removal for SPI flash chips. Built-in Hex Editor neoprogrammer 21019 ch341a link
NeoProgrammer 2.1.0.19 (often abbreviated as NeoProgrammer 21019) is a powerful, lightweight alternative to the official software for the . This specific version is widely sought after by electronics hobbyists and technicians because it bridges the gap between basic BIOS flashing and advanced chip manipulation, often replacing older tools like ASProgrammer. Key Features of NeoProgrammer 2.1.0.19 This is where enters the scene
It handles SPI NOR/NAND flash, I2C/SPI/MicroWire EEPROMs (24/25/93/95 series), and even specific MCU families like AVR (ATmega, ATtiny). This version is notable for several key improvements: